Ingredients
-
4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
-
1½ cups broccoli florets, finely chopped
-
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
-
4 oz cream cheese, softened
-
1 teaspoon garlic powder
-
½ teaspoon onion powder
-
½ teaspoon paprika
-
½ teaspoon salt
-
¼ teaspoon black pepper
-
1 tablespoon olive oil
-
½ cup chicken broth
Instructions
Step 1: Preheat and Prep
-
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
-
Lightly grease a baking dish with olive oil or non-stick spray.
Step 2: Make the Filling
-
In a medium bowl, mix together:
-
Chopped broccoli
-
Shredded cheddar cheese
-
Softened cream cheese
-
Garlic powder
-
Onion powder
-
Paprika
-
Salt and pepper
-
Step 3: Flatten and Stuff the Chicken
-
Pound each chicken breast to about ¼-inch thickness using a meat mallet or rolling pin (place between plastic wrap or in a zip-top bag).
-
Divide the broccoli-cheddar mixture evenly among the chicken breasts.
-
Roll each one up tightly and secure with toothpicks.
Step 4: Bake the Rollups
-
Place chicken rollups seam-side down in the prepared baking dish.
-
Drizzle olive oil over the top and pour chicken broth into the dish around the rollups.
-
Cover with foil and bake for 25 minutes.
-
Remove foil and bake an additional 10 minutes, or until golden and cooked through (internal temp should reach 165°F).
Notes
-
Use sharp cheddar for bold flavor, or mix in mozzarella for a stretchier filling.
